2. Use a VPN Service

A Virtual Private Network (VPN) is indispensable for accessing international channels without geo-restrictions. By masking your IP address, a VPN allows you to appear as if you are browsing from another country, effectively enabling access to content only available in specific regions. Here’s how to maximize the benefits of a VPN:

Selecting Your VPN

When looking for the best VPN service, pay attention to:

  • Server Locations: VPNs with servers in multiple countries can provide access to a more extensive range of channels.
  • Speed and Reliability: Opt for services known for fast connection speeds that can handle streaming without interruptions.

4. Consider Using an Antenna

For those who prefer traditional television experiences, an antenna can help you access local channels without any subscription fees. Antennas can pick up signals from broadcast towers, allowing you access to various stations depending on your proximity.

Types of Antennas

  • Indoor Antennas: Best for urban areas where signals are stronger. They are easy to set up and require little technical know-how.
  • Outdoor Antennas: These tend to have a broader range and can access channels from further away, ideal for rural settings where reception may be limited.

Are there legal implications for accessing foreign TV channels?

Yes, there can be legal implications when accessing foreign TV channels, depending on your location and the policies of the channel providers. Some channels are restricted to specific regions due to licensing agreements, and bypassing these restrictions can violate terms of service. It’s important to understand the laws of your country regarding streaming and accessing foreign media content to avoid potential penalties.

Moreover, using a VPN might complicate legal matters, as some streaming services actively block VPN traffic to enforce their regional restrictions. It’s advisable to conduct thorough research and possibly consult legal sources if you’re uncertain about the legality of accessing certain channels. Being informed can help you make better choices while enjoying global entertainment safely and legally.

Can I watch international TV channels for free?

While there are some legitimate ways to watch international TV channels for free, options may be limited and often vary by region. Many broadcasters offer live streaming of their channels through official websites or mobile apps, allowing access to some content at no cost. Additionally, platforms like YouTube may host certain broadcasts or clips from international channels, giving viewers free exposure to foreign programming.

However, it’s essential to be cautious with free streaming websites, as they often come with risks such as malware or copyright infringement. Many of these sites operate in legal gray areas and may violate the terms of service of the original broadcasters. Therefore, while free options exist, using reputable sources ensures a safer and more reliable viewing experience.

Can I record international TV shows for later viewing?

Yes, many services allow you to record international TV shows for later viewing, but options may vary. Subscription-based services often come with DVR capabilities, allowing users to record live broadcasts and watch them at a convenient time. This feature is particularly useful for popular shows that may air during inconvenient hours or for catching up on episodes that you’ve missed.

However, with streaming platforms, the ability to record shows can depend on the specific service’s policies. Some may offer a cloud DVR option that enables you to save content for a limited period. Always review the features of any streaming service before subscribing, as you may find varied capabilities regarding program recording and storage, which could influence your viewing choices.
